    "content": "Mr. Temporary Deputy Speaker, Sir, I welcome the opening of the Lamu Corridor. But the northern corridor which has got the Port of Mombasa and serves countries which are landlocked such as Uganda, DRC, and Rwanda must be taken full advantage of. The Port of Mombasa must be properly modernized, so that it can take its position within the region. Otherwise, you might lose transport activities to central corridor which uses the Port of Dar-es-Salaam. Whereas, the Lamu Port will take sometime to be operationalised, the Port of Mombasa is existing. If we dredge it, we will allow bigger ships to dock. We should also upgrade the road from Mombasa to the Uganda border. If we do the railway line, we will take full advantage of the existing facility at the Port of Mombasa. So, the Port of Mombasa must be modernized as a priority. The attention we have given to Lamu should equally be given to the Port of Mombasa. We have it and it is something we can deal with quickly. I am happy that the Ministry is talking about commercialising some operations of the Port, so that we can compete with other ports. A country like Djibouti depends only on its airport. Kenya should as well take full advantage of the Mombasa Port."
